Overview

Postcode SW1V 4BN is located in a major urban area, within the Pimlico North ward of Westminster in the London region, and forms part of the Pimlico North area. It has average de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 33.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 74%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Pimlico North is £81,743 per year. The nearest station is Victoria, about 0.3 miles away. There are 8 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 4 parks nearby, the closest small park is St. George's Square.

Property prices in Pimlico North

Median price£655,000
Price per sq ft£1,008
Sales (last 12 months)119
Typical range (middle 50%)£555K – £873K

Based on 119 recent sales, the median property price is £655,000 (about £1,008 per square foot) in Pimlico North area, with individual transactions ranging from £100,000 up to £3,800,000.
